Etymology[edit]

First attested as Kamp Vijf-Hoeven in 1868. Compound of vijf (five) and the plural form of hoeve (piece of land of a certain size, farmstead).

Proper noun[edit]

Vijfhoeven n

  1. A neighbourhood of Heusden, Noord-Brabant, Netherlands.
